Transaction 81e673de053aadba4d4409a81a59af5fbdee21fa65acf1ea973ad432ccaa6ee2

1 Input
2 Outputs
  • 81e673de053aadba4d4409a81a59af5fbdee21fa65acf1ea973ad432ccaa6ee2:0
  • value  222000
    address  16pzzgCDCQ3fcUkKoyVDBBMZhA1sAjGJop
  • 81e673de053aadba4d4409a81a59af5fbdee21fa65acf1ea973ad432ccaa6ee2:1
  • value  69843440
    address  342BMyATipnFT1SYLyspJ5pqs9oL8aJeXG